1. This is a very last minute add on to a cruise vacation, so I'm freaking out. We will be there in 2 weeks.

2. We are staying off site.

3. MK has EMH 8-9 in the morning the day we are going. Park hours are 9-10.

My question is when should we arrive at MK gates? When is the earliest we would be able to get in? Do they ever let off-site people enter bit earlier on EMH days or would it be right at 9am?

A. That's a tough one. I'd be parked and at the TTC terminal (ferry or monorail to MK) by 7:50-8:00AM.
They will be delaying the MK arrival from TTC due to the AM EMH. It should be very crowded at TTC.
B. You may be able to get to the MK gates by about 8:20, or so. (Whenever they do start running the ferry and monorail.)
C. You may be admitted onto Main St. (only) by 8:30, or so.
They will offer the MK Welcome show on the Castle Stage at about 8:55AM.
C. Don't count on being able to get to any MK attractions until nearly 9:00AM.

Sorry to say that you are going to be in a crowded situation by going to MK on an AM EMH morning and not
be able to enter until the end of AM EMH.
 
I just want to add to robo post that if you don't know all guests are let in early to main street and the hub. Leaving the hub into a land is where you will be stopped and checked if you are a resort guest... So you can get into main street and the hub before 9, but you are going to be limited to that. Casey's, the ice cream shop and starbucks will all be opened before 9 to get some breakfast items.

Also will mention that sometimes they don't actually check anyone or they leave early and stop checking if it's a very light crowd so you may get past the hub before 9. Don't make plans with that happening though because most of the time you won't get past.
 
What has been happening is that WDW Resort guests (who arrive on WDW buses) are allowed onto Main St. as early as 9AM,
they have been holding guests at the MK Parking Lot/TTC until closer to 8:30. (They don't run the Express monorail nor ferry boats until near 8:30.)

Then, after 8:30, or so, they have been checking at the Hub entrance to Tomorrowland (and/or Fantasyland) for WDW Resort guests.

These things can change on a dime at WDW,
but that has been the AM EMH procedure since about the 3rd week after they began the 8AM opening to Main St.

Is there another day you can do it (after the cruise instead of before or vice versa) or any chance you could book a campsite or stay at once or the values? The thought of one day at MK without the rope drop benefit makes me extremely anxious just thinking about it. You will get as much done in that hour as you will the 4-6 hours in the middle of the day (not counting fast passes).

If your current option is the only one possible: try to book breakfast at be our guest or one of the other options as early as possible and be willing to just eat the 20 dollar cancelation fee. If you can't do that, get there at 8 and go as far as they let you go. With the new welcome show I'm actually not sure where they hold non EMH guests but I assume it is in the hub. (Side question to anyone that knows: do they scan bands in the hub for onsite guests that arrive late?)

Anyway, assuming you don't get breakfast reservations to get you into the park early, line up as early as you can for frontierland and adventureland as they are not open for EMH. Knock out big thunder, slash, pirates, jungle cruise and haunted mansion or as many of those as you can before lines get long. Have your FP for space, pan, and if by some miracle you can get it 7dmt. If not mine train go with one of the mountains you want to repeat or something else with long waits. I would book these for the late morning and early afternoon so you can grab additional FP on your phone as you need them.
